RAMBEAU v. State

Jason S. RAMBEAU, Appellant, v. STATE of Florida, Appellee.

District Court of Appeal of Florida · decided 2008-07-16

Relies on 830 So. 2d 172 - Trapkin v. State · Warren v. State

Decided 2008-07-16

¶1Jason S. Rambeau, Arcadia, pro se.

¶2No appearance required for appellee.

¶3PER CURIAM.

¶4The order denying appellant's rule 3.800(a) motion is affirmed without prejudice for appellant to file a new motion that indicates where in the court file or jail *1226 records information can be located that shows he is entitled to additional credit for jail time served. Warren v. State,980 So.2d 1204 (Fla. 4th DCA 2008); Trapkin v. State,830 So.2d 172 (Fla. 4th DCA 2002). If appellant files a new motion, the trial court should consider the jail records in determining whether appellant is entitled to relief.

¶5Affirmed.

¶6FARMER, TAYLOR and MAY, JJ., concur.
